 I'm installing the new SDK 1.0.0 which has voxl-suite 1.0.0. When trying to install ros-melodic-tf2-geometry-msgsI get the following error:voxl2:~$ apt install -y ros-melodic-tf2-geometry-msgs Reading package lists... Done Building dependency tree Reading state information... Done Some packages could not be installed. This may mean that you have requested an impossible situation or if you are using the unstable distribution that some required packages have not yet been created or been moved out of Incoming. The following information may help to resolve the situation: The following packages have unmet dependencies: ros-melodic-tf2-geometry-msgs : Depends: ros-melodic-orocos-kdl but it is not going to be installed Depends: ros-melodic-python-orocos-kdl but it is not going to be installed E: Unable to correct problems, you have held broken packages.I dove into it a little bit more and the issue is that ros-melodic-tf2-geometry-msgsdepends onros-melodic-orocos-kdlwhich in turn depends onlibeigen3-dev.But voxl-suitenow depends onvoxl-feature-trackerwhich depends onvoxl-eigen3andvoxl-eigen3conflicts withlibeigen3-dev:voxl2:~$ apt show voxl-eigen3 Package: voxl-eigen3 Version: 3.4.0 Priority: optional Section: base Maintainer: matt.turi@modalai.com Installed-Size: unknown Conflicts: libeigen3-dev Replaces: libeigen3-dev, lib32-libeigen Download-Size: 1014 kB APT-Manual-Installed: yes APT-Sources: file:/data/voxl-suite-offline-packages ./ Packages Description: Eigen3 Library packaged up for APQWhat is the recommended way to get ros-melodic-tf2-geometry-msgsinstalled? In our case we don't needvoxl-feature-tracker. Is there a way to combine it withvoxl-eigen3? Or should we just not usevoxl-suite?
